To answer your questions
Q1: Do we turn on the light in that Aerograden all day night 24 x 7 in a month?
A: Everything about the AeroGarden is automated once you plant the seeds. The light is on a timer, and comes on for a set amount of time each day depending on what your growing. So on the chilli/pepper setting I believe the light comes on for 8 hours each day. It is advised to change the bulbs every 6 months.
Q2: And do we need to spray water or something to make it like conventional gardening where we need water, ground / fertilizer?
A: No need to spray water on the plants at all. Unless you get some little fruit flys on them. In which case you just do as you would normally to remove. The plants stay in the AeroGarden permanently. It is a soil free growing environment. Meaning the roots are suspended in the water bowl, and every 2 weeks you apply a liquid feed to the water bowl. The AeroGarden takes care of the rest by providing light and pumping the water/feed combo up and around the base of the plant.
